The median hourly wage among practicing nutrition and dietetics technicians, registered (NDTRs) is $23.22 per hour, equating to an annualized full-time salary of approximately $48,300 per year. Shift differential premiums for hourly employees are usually calculated as either a percentage of hourly pay rate or as an additional flat amount. Alternatively, they may receive an extra flat amount for each hour worked or for each shift worked.
